dc.description.abstractThe aim of this paper is to prove the existence of the solution to the Cauchy problem for the time distributed order diffusion equation as well as to calculate it. The existence is proved in this paper by reducing the Cauchy problem to an abstract Volterra equation in the case where the weight distribution in the distributed order derivative is a finite sum of Dirac distributions. Calculation of the solution is done by the use of Fourier and Laplace transformations in the case where the weight distribution (or function) is not specified. The solution is expressed in terms of heat potential kernel. The solutions for several special cases of the weight distribution, including the case of a finite sum of Dirac distributions, are presented as well.en
